One last shot from the palace armoury. This is a row of bronze cannons that one can see at the armoury. On the right is a close-up of the coat of arms of Grand Master de Vilhena’s ( Grand Master between1722-1736) embossed in bronze. One of these cannons could have cost as much as it was needed to build one of the Order’s galleys.
